acm-header
Sign In

Communications of the ACM

News


Latest News News Archive Refine your search:
dateMore Than a Year Ago
subjectSoftware
authorEsther Shein
bg-corner

An edited collection of advanced computing news from Communications of the ACM, ACM TechNews, other ACM resources, and news sites around the Web.


Shining a Light on the Dark Web
From Communications of the ACM

Shining a Light on the Dark Web

How the Dark Web continues to operate, and why law enforcement will not shut it down anytime soon.

A Nested Inventory for Software Security, Supply Chain Risk Management
From ACM News

A Nested Inventory for Software Security, Supply Chain Risk Management

The growing importance of the Software Bill of Materials

Capturing What is Said
From ACM News

Capturing What is Said

Artificial intelligence is boosting the capabilities of automatic speech recognition.

First, There Were Bug Bounties. Now, Here Come the Bias Bounties
From ACM News

First, There Were Bug Bounties. Now, Here Come the Bias Bounties

Offering rewards for the identification of bias in algorithms.

Converting Laws to Programs
From Communications of the ACM

Converting Laws to Programs

In highly regulated industries, it is critical that laws are translated precisely into code that reflects their intent.

Filtering for Beauty
From Communications of the ACM

Filtering for Beauty

Social media "influencers" use augmented reality filtering apps to appear more beautiful, together, and cool. Results may vary.

The Next Best Thing to Being There
From ACM News

The Next Best Thing to Being There

Encouraged by the pandemic, augmented and mixed realities bring new views to end-users in medicine, industry, and the military.

How Universities Deploy Student Data
From Communications of the ACM

How Universities Deploy Student Data

Personalizing efforts to drive greater student retention and success.

Open Source Professionals in Demand
From ACM News

Open Source Professionals in Demand

An "increasingly open source world" needs specialists in Linux and other open source technologies.

Software Without Coding
From ACM News

Software Without Coding

"Citizen Developers" can create new applications via low-code development.

DevOps Momentum in the Enterprise
From ACM News

DevOps Momentum in the Enterprise

The notion of unifying software development and software operation is catching on.

Open Source Powers Supercomputing
From ACM News

Open Source Powers Supercomputing

The Top 500 supercomputers in the world run Linux.

Hacker-Proof Coding
From Communications of the ACM

Hacker-Proof Coding

Software verification helps find the faults, preventing hacks.

How AI Is Changing Software Development
From ACM News

How AI Is Changing Software Development

Artificial intelligence technologies like advanced machine learning, deep learning, and natural language processing will help build better software faster.

Chatbots Take Off
From ACM News

Chatbots Take Off

Companies are exploring the use of a "human dialogue interface" to interact with customers and employees more effectively.

Preserving the Internet
From Communications of the ACM

Preserving the Internet

Is the Internet ephemeral by its nature, or can it be archived?

Companies Proactively Seek Out Internal Threats
From Communications of the ACM

Companies Proactively Seek Out Internal Threats

Organizations must balance their concerns with the protection of employee privacy.

Python For Beginners
From Communications of the ACM

Python For Beginners

A survey found the language in use in introductory programming classes in the top U.S. computer science schools.

Bringing Coding to Kindergarten
From ACM News

Bringing Coding to Kindergarten

How young is too young to learn to write software?

Ephemeral Data
From Communications of the ACM

Ephemeral Data

Privacy issues can evaporate when embarrassing content does likewise.
Sign In for Full Access
» Forgot Password? » Create an ACM Web Account